Even tonight, like any other Saturday, numerous citizens gathered in the square and continued toward the RTS building.
Janko Veselinovic said that if the government does not meet their demands and dialogue with them, then they will appoint some professional people to contact the authorities.
At this rally, it was said they would continue with protests until victory.

Since December last year, protests are under way in Serbia to challenge Vuciqi's autocratic rule and restrict media freedom.
Last month, a group of protesters had entered the public broadcaster building, RTS requesting permission to submit their demands. However, the police had managed to get them out of the building.
On the other hand, President Alexander Vuciq rally to rally his supporters.
